Betteshanger Brass Band

Based in the South East of England near the coastal towns of Dover, Folkestone and the historic city of Canterbury.

Deal based Betteshanger Brass Band formed in 1932 by miner George Gibb and his colleagues as a tool for relaxation after their days toil underground. The Band can now be found at the ‘Betteshanger Social Welfare Sports Club’ situated at the Welfare Sports Ground, Cavell Square, Mill Hill, Deal, Kent.

MASSACHUSETTS DIVISIONAL BAND
B/M William L. Rollins, conductor
Captain Eduardo Zuniga, executive officer

The Massachusetts Divisional Band, affectionately know as Mass Brass, is an ensemble of active Salvation Army bandsmen and bandmasters from the corps in the state of Massachusetts. This group provides one outlet for expressing the spiritual relationship we have with Jesus Christ. It also provides a support network for the musical and artistic ministry of the Corps in the Massachusetts Division.
